Ok numnuts, here's the deal for those of you trying to break a record for going the longest you can without filling your Focus. Your going to be sorry. The fuel pump in any car uses the gasoline in the tank to cool the pump. When you start to run down below 1/4 of a tank, the pump becomes exposed more and more with the depletion of fuel. The more exposed, the hotter the pump becomes. And sooner or later it's going to overheat.
